Rocket League Goes Batty

Psyonix and Warner Bros. Interactive Entertainment have decided to go a little Batty to cross promote the impending release of DC’s latest comic book movie Batman v Superman.  This isn’t the first iconic car to jump on to the pitch, as last year the Deloren, made famous by Back to the Future, was made available as DLC as well.  The trailer and full press release is below.

SAN DIEGO, CA – February 25, 2016 – Independent video game developer and publisher, Psyonix, and Warner Bros. Interactive Entertainment, are pleased to announce that fans of Rocket League will soon take control of the world-famous and iconic Batmobile from the highly anticipated Warner Bros. Pictures film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ice.

Available Tuesday, March 8, the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ice Car Pack will put players behind the wheel of the renowned crime-fighting vehicle, which has been faithfully re-created in Rocket League, to mirror Batman’s ride in the upcoming film. In addition to the Batmobile itself, the Car Pack also will include three exclusive Antenna Flags enabling players to show their allegiance to World’s Finest trinity: Batman, Superman and Wonder Woman.

Priced at $1.99 USD (or regional equivalent), the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ice Car Pack is licensed by Warner Bros. Interactive Entertainment and will release on the PlayStation®4 computer entertainment system, Xbox One, and Windows PC via Steam.
